National Youth Week Nominations 2011

Posted: February 9, 2011


As part of the celebrations for National Youth Week (NYW) for 2011 the Youth Development workers Rebecca Schroder and Bonita Tyler are organising two awards nights (one in Stanthorpe and one in Warwick) to celebrate the contributions of young people to the communities across the Southern Downs Regional Council area.

NYW is a joint Australian, state, territory and local government initiative. NYW is coordinated by the Australian Government Department of Education, Employment and Workplace Relations, in collaboration with the state and territory government departments responsible for youth affairs.

The theme for National Youth Week for 2011 is ‘OWN IT’ and will be held from Friday the 1st – Sunday 10th of April.

Under the theme of ‘Own It’ we decided it would be a good year for young people to nominate and be nominated for awards which acknowledge the contributions Young People make to the development and life of small communities. Each year we see 100’s of young people volunteer to help with youth and community projects across the Southern Downs and it would be great to see some of those people recognised for the time they give our community.

We would like to encourage everyone to think about a young person who makes a difference in their workplace, sport or community.
